how to bypass 401 authorization required

how to bypass 401 authorization required

In order to fix the error 'AADSTS50105, you must turn off User Assignment else assign groups or users to the application. Then you can remove that plugin, replace it with a new one, or contact its developer for assistance. You can then use the site menus to navigate to your desired location. Find out more about the causes and fixes. New-AuthenticationPolicy -Name "<Descriptive Name>". I do understand that disabling user assignment would let all users pass through to my app where I could do my own authorization and it would eliminate the issue. How to send a header using a HTTP request through a cURL call? Shouldn't it return them there? Like most errors like these, you can find them in all browsers that run on any operating system. I've tried the highest-voted answers from here: How do I make a request using HTTP basic authentication with PHP curl? Most applications need to control who (or what) can access data or call services. HTTP/1.1 401 Unauthorized Server: nginx/1.11.9 Date: Thu, 16 Aug 2018 01:22:08 GMT Content-Type: text/html Content-Length: 195 Connection: keep-alive. The Making statements based on opinion; back them up with references or personal experience. Before diving into JMeter configuration, let's first understand how Basic Authentication works.. Don't fall asleep there, the nice things come after!. User types and privileges Admin users Shouldn't it be processed before reaching the location / in the SSL section, which is the one requiring authentication? Clearing your browser cache might also fix the issue. As an alternative, try root as a user name and the SSH root password of the machine. Forbidden is to Bypass 4xx HTTP response status codes. Hi! At that point, it's probably bestto contact the website owner or other website contact and inform them of the problem. 401 errors occur on restricted resources, such as password-protected pages of your WordPress site. {"Message":"Authorization has been denied for this request."} To overcome this issue, we need to find a way how to bypass this restriction as Burpsuite require a valid token each time it performs scanning as well as the repeater and intruder. If the calls go out thru a FAC/CMC enabled RP there's no bypass, you would need to create a new RP without FAC/CMC and provide them with some prefix so they route calls thru it. Step 2. This typically happens when a device is taken off-network but the web traffic is still being forwarded to Umbrella using PAC file. Authentication bypass vulnerability is generally caused . You either supplied the wrong credentials (e.g., bad password), or your browser doesn't understand how to supply the credentials required. Try our world-class support team! It will include the phrase HTTP Error 401 at the bottom, and instruct you to contact the sites owner if the problem persists: At other times and in other browsers, you might get a slightly less friendly warning thats just a blank page with a 401 Authorization Required message: These errors occur on websites that require a login in order to access them. Workaround for Microsoft Edge browser ("Authorization Required") bug: 1) Click on this intermediate file link 2) Write in your username and password to authenticate yourself 3) Navigate back to the page containing the PDF files and then click on the date of the desired PDF file. Using Burp to Attack Authentication. Double-check the URL to make sure it's accurate, and if so reload the page. Do you usually struggle to remember your passwords? This problem may cause the Web access attempt to fail. Applying security. It was time to bring out a heavier hitter. . A server using HTTP authentication will respond with a 401 Unauthorized response to a request for a protected resource. And select Single Target option and there give the IP of your victim PC. I know I could set User Assignment Required in the AD App settings to No and then everyone would just get passed on through and then my code could do the authorization but I like the security of AD doing it. Fuzz HTTP Headers: Try using HTTP Proxy Headers, HTTP Authentication Basic and NTLM brute-force (with a few combinations only) and other . So its safe to assume that the cause of the problem has something to do with the authentication credentials. For example, in Mozilla Firefox, you would click on the library icon in the top-right corner of the browser, followed by History> Clear Recent History: In the panel that opens next, selectEverythingin the drop-down menu at the top, make sure Cache is selected, and then click on the Clear Nowbutton: If youre using a different browser, please refer to this guide for clearing the cache. Should we burninate the [variations] tag? At other times, this error is caused by a plugin incompatibility or error.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S. The settings in the portal and in your application must match in order for this to work. This works flawlessly UNLESS the user has a valid Microsoft Senior Vice President & Group General Manager, Tech & Sustainability. auth_required () takes parameters that define how recent the authentication must have happened. About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ators . The code is sent via the WWW-Authenticate header, whichis responsible for identifying the authentication method used for granting access to a web page or resource. Then under the Bulk Actionsdrop-down menu, select Deactivateand click on the Apply button: After that, try reloading the page that returned the 401 error to see if this has resolved the issue. Results will be sorted by HTTP response status code ascending, content length descending, and ID ascending. HTTP 400 status codes are encountered when there is a problem making a request. Options. Youll be auto redirected in 1 second. But this error message comes in different shapes and sizes. We'll get back to you in one business day. You can find out more about our use, change your default settings, and withdraw your consent at any time with effect for the future by visiting Cookies Settings, which can also be found in the footer of the site. And select HTTP in the box against Protocol option and give the port number 80 against the port option. If you typed it in yourself, verify that you spelled everything correctly. Its fairly rare that a DNS error will end up promoting yo with a 401 Unauthorized error in your browser, but it can definitely happen. Check for errors in the URL. Web servers running Microsoft IIS might give more information about the 401 Unauthorized error, such as the following: You can learn more about IIS-specific codes on Microsoft'sthe HTTP status code in IIS 7 and later versionspage. Reload the page. This will clean out any invalid information thats locally stored in your browser, which could be interrupting the authentication process. where all they see is some JSON and a 401 error. Most sites have a log-in button in the top-left or top-right corner of the screen. To add a new authorization: In the Authorization drop-down list, select Add New Authorization.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. If you cant wait, contact them immediately and ask them to check if they have a case of false login requirement. You can right-click on the page and select Inspect, or use Ctrl+Shift+J. If your browser isnt using the valid authentication credentials (or any at all), the server will reject the request. BYPASSING AUTHENTICATION BY USER AGENT. For example, a firewall or security plugin can mistake your login attempt as malicious activity, and return a 401 error to protect the page. You can use the IsAuthenticated class to check if the user is authenticated and then redirect the user to a different page if he or she is not authenticated. How Do You Fix It? This particular HTTP status code is signaling that the page youre trying to access will not load until you sign in with a valid user ID and/or password. Getting 404 pages on your site? Azure App Service provides built-in authentication and authorization capabilities (sometimes referred to as "Easy Auth"), so you can sign in users and access data by writing minimal or no code in your web app, RESTful API, and mobile back end, and also Azure Functions.This article describes how App Service helps simplify authentication and authorization for your app. Select the Status header to sort the table and locate the 401 status code: The 401 status code in the developer console in Chrome Select that entry, and then click on the Headers tab. To make scripted clients (such as wget) invoke operations that require authorization (such as scheduling a build), use HTTP BASIC authentication to specify the user name and the API token. 1. Attackers could also bypass the authentication mechanism by stealing the valid session IDs or cookies. Visit Microsoft Q&A to post new questions. JSON should be sent back to my app! refer: admin: Grants access to admin operations. That does not seem like desired behavior. Both versions work. Is your goal simply to create a custom error message or direct the users to a specific landing page if they are not authenticated? A number of server-side HTTP status codes also exist, like the often-seen 500 Internal Server Error. In my use case, we are monitoring hundreds sites from about a dozen state agencies. 401 errors can happen within any browser so the message appearing may differ. How to Resolve Ticketmaster Error 401 Not Allowed? It must be either `bypass`, # `one_factor`, `two_factor` or `deny`. I guess what I'm not making clear is that when a user successfully authenticates with AD but is not in the assigned users list, *I* (my server, my code) am *not* getting back an error message that I can act on. While this is a rarer issue, it canbe a possible cause, so its worth giving it a try if the first two solutions dont work. This may sound simple, but 401 errors can sometimes appear if the URL wasnt correctly entered in. Here are five methods you can use to fix the 401 error: Save time, costs and maximize site performance with: All of that and much more, in one plan with no long-term contracts, assisted migrations, and a 30-day-money-back-guarantee. Now to identify the roles and user rights for that authenticated user application needs to perform authorization checks. Set your Reply URL in the app registration and in the web.config (or app settings) to wherever you want the user to be directed. If youre only visiting big sites, then you are used to the following scenario: You enter your log-in information but you mistype your password or email. Alternatively, you can follow the procedure below: Copy the RemoteConnector folder from the installation directory to a location where you have read/write permissions. This can be done in the following ways. If you clicked on a link, confirm that its pointing to the page youre trying to access (or try to visit that page directly through the website). Search on google . Clearing the cache will remove any problems in those files and give the page an opportunity to download fresh files directly from the server. What exactly makes a black hole STAY a black hole? Depending on the site youre accessing, you might see this error message along with other graphic elements, as opposed to plaintext on a white background. Do check authorization behavior section for additional options. I do have the Reply URL set. If youre a frequent browser, chances are youll encounter this message at some point. How to Track and Manage the IP Addresses on your Network using IP Address Manager. If it has, you can manually activate each plugin one at a time, in order to determine which one is causing the problem. The following messages are also client-side errors and so are related to the 401 Unauthorized error:400 Bad Request,403 Forbidden,404 Not Found, and408 Request Timeout. How can i extract files in the directory where they're located with the find command? What's the difference between 401 Unauthorized and 403 Forbidden? Global audience reach with 35 data centers worldwide. A complete list of HTTP status codes with explaination of what they are, why they occur and what you can do to fix them. I get a 401 because it keeps asking for credentials. To create a policy that blocks Basic authentication for all available client protocols in Exchange Online (the recommended configuration), use the following syntax: PowerShell. Flush the DNS: Errors in DNS also creates 401 error status sometimes. Found footage movie where teens get superpowers after getting struck by lightning? How To Create Web App In Android Studio, Dinamo Zagreb Vs Hajduk Split Tv, Drenched In Liquid Crossword, Emarketer Ecommerce Growth, Gatsby Allow Cross Origin, Ark Additions Xiphactinus, Every Summer After Summary,

In order to fix the error 'AADSTS50105, you must turn off User Assignment else assign groups or users to the application. Then you can remove that plugin, replace it with a new one, or contact its developer for assistance. You can then use the site menus to navigate to your desired location. Find out more about the causes and fixes. New-AuthenticationPolicy -Name "<Descriptive Name>". I do understand that disabling user assignment would let all users pass through to my app where I could do my own authorization and it would eliminate the issue. How to send a header using a HTTP request through a cURL call? Shouldn't it return them there? Like most errors like these, you can find them in all browsers that run on any operating system. I've tried the highest-voted answers from here: How do I make a request using HTTP basic authentication with PHP curl? Most applications need to control who (or what) can access data or call services. HTTP/1.1 401 Unauthorized Server: nginx/1.11.9 Date: Thu, 16 Aug 2018 01:22:08 GMT Content-Type: text/html Content-Length: 195 Connection: keep-alive. The Making statements based on opinion; back them up with references or personal experience. Before diving into JMeter configuration, let's first understand how Basic Authentication works.. Don't fall asleep there, the nice things come after!. User types and privileges Admin users Shouldn't it be processed before reaching the location / in the SSL section, which is the one requiring authentication? Clearing your browser cache might also fix the issue. As an alternative, try root as a user name and the SSH root password of the machine. Forbidden is to Bypass 4xx HTTP response status codes. Hi! At that point, it's probably bestto contact the website owner or other website contact and inform them of the problem. 401 errors occur on restricted resources, such as password-protected pages of your WordPress site. {"Message":"Authorization has been denied for this request."} To overcome this issue, we need to find a way how to bypass this restriction as Burpsuite require a valid token each time it performs scanning as well as the repeater and intruder. If the calls go out thru a FAC/CMC enabled RP there's no bypass, you would need to create a new RP without FAC/CMC and provide them with some prefix so they route calls thru it. Step 2. This typically happens when a device is taken off-network but the web traffic is still being forwarded to Umbrella using PAC file. Authentication bypass vulnerability is generally caused . You either supplied the wrong credentials (e.g., bad password), or your browser doesn't understand how to supply the credentials required. Try our world-class support team! It will include the phrase HTTP Error 401 at the bottom, and instruct you to contact the sites owner if the problem persists: At other times and in other browsers, you might get a slightly less friendly warning thats just a blank page with a 401 Authorization Required message: These errors occur on websites that require a login in order to access them. Workaround for Microsoft Edge browser ("Authorization Required") bug: 1) Click on this intermediate file link 2) Write in your username and password to authenticate yourself 3) Navigate back to the page containing the PDF files and then click on the date of the desired PDF file. Using Burp to Attack Authentication. Double-check the URL to make sure it's accurate, and if so reload the page. Do you usually struggle to remember your passwords? This problem may cause the Web access attempt to fail. Applying security. It was time to bring out a heavier hitter. . A server using HTTP authentication will respond with a 401 Unauthorized response to a request for a protected resource. And select Single Target option and there give the IP of your victim PC. I know I could set User Assignment Required in the AD App settings to No and then everyone would just get passed on through and then my code could do the authorization but I like the security of AD doing it. Fuzz HTTP Headers: Try using HTTP Proxy Headers, HTTP Authentication Basic and NTLM brute-force (with a few combinations only) and other . So its safe to assume that the cause of the problem has something to do with the authentication credentials. For example, in Mozilla Firefox, you would click on the library icon in the top-right corner of the browser, followed by History> Clear Recent History: In the panel that opens next, selectEverythingin the drop-down menu at the top, make sure Cache is selected, and then click on the Clear Nowbutton: If youre using a different browser, please refer to this guide for clearing the cache. Should we burninate the [variations] tag? At other times, this error is caused by a plugin incompatibility or error.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S. The settings in the portal and in your application must match in order for this to work. This works flawlessly UNLESS the user has a valid Microsoft Senior Vice President & Group General Manager, Tech & Sustainability. auth_required () takes parameters that define how recent the authentication must have happened. About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ators . The code is sent via the WWW-Authenticate header, whichis responsible for identifying the authentication method used for granting access to a web page or resource. Then under the Bulk Actionsdrop-down menu, select Deactivateand click on the Apply button: After that, try reloading the page that returned the 401 error to see if this has resolved the issue. Results will be sorted by HTTP response status code ascending, content length descending, and ID ascending. HTTP 400 status codes are encountered when there is a problem making a request. Options. Youll be auto redirected in 1 second. But this error message comes in different shapes and sizes. We'll get back to you in one business day. You can find out more about our use, change your default settings, and withdraw your consent at any time with effect for the future by visiting Cookies Settings, which can also be found in the footer of the site. And select HTTP in the box against Protocol option and give the port number 80 against the port option. If you typed it in yourself, verify that you spelled everything correctly. Its fairly rare that a DNS error will end up promoting yo with a 401 Unauthorized error in your browser, but it can definitely happen. Check for errors in the URL. Web servers running Microsoft IIS might give more information about the 401 Unauthorized error, such as the following: You can learn more about IIS-specific codes on Microsoft'sthe HTTP status code in IIS 7 and later versionspage. Reload the page. This will clean out any invalid information thats locally stored in your browser, which could be interrupting the authentication process. where all they see is some JSON and a 401 error. Most sites have a log-in button in the top-left or top-right corner of the screen. To add a new authorization: In the Authorization drop-down list, select Add New Authorization.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. If you cant wait, contact them immediately and ask them to check if they have a case of false login requirement. You can right-click on the page and select Inspect, or use Ctrl+Shift+J. If your browser isnt using the valid authentication credentials (or any at all), the server will reject the request. BYPASSING AUTHENTICATION BY USER AGENT. For example, a firewall or security plugin can mistake your login attempt as malicious activity, and return a 401 error to protect the page. You can use the IsAuthenticated class to check if the user is authenticated and then redirect the user to a different page if he or she is not authenticated. How Do You Fix It? This particular HTTP status code is signaling that the page youre trying to access will not load until you sign in with a valid user ID and/or password. Getting 404 pages on your site? Azure App Service provides built-in authentication and authorization capabilities (sometimes referred to as "Easy Auth"), so you can sign in users and access data by writing minimal or no code in your web app, RESTful API, and mobile back end, and also Azure Functions.This article describes how App Service helps simplify authentication and authorization for your app. Select the Status header to sort the table and locate the 401 status code: The 401 status code in the developer console in Chrome Select that entry, and then click on the Headers tab. To make scripted clients (such as wget) invoke operations that require authorization (such as scheduling a build), use HTTP BASIC authentication to specify the user name and the API token. 1. Attackers could also bypass the authentication mechanism by stealing the valid session IDs or cookies. Visit Microsoft Q&A to post new questions. JSON should be sent back to my app! refer: admin: Grants access to admin operations. That does not seem like desired behavior. Both versions work. Is your goal simply to create a custom error message or direct the users to a specific landing page if they are not authenticated? A number of server-side HTTP status codes also exist, like the often-seen 500 Internal Server Error. In my use case, we are monitoring hundreds sites from about a dozen state agencies. 401 errors can happen within any browser so the message appearing may differ. How to Resolve Ticketmaster Error 401 Not Allowed? It must be either `bypass`, # `one_factor`, `two_factor` or `deny`. I guess what I'm not making clear is that when a user successfully authenticates with AD but is not in the assigned users list, *I* (my server, my code) am *not* getting back an error message that I can act on. While this is a rarer issue, it canbe a possible cause, so its worth giving it a try if the first two solutions dont work. This may sound simple, but 401 errors can sometimes appear if the URL wasnt correctly entered in. Here are five methods you can use to fix the 401 error: Save time, costs and maximize site performance with: All of that and much more, in one plan with no long-term contracts, assisted migrations, and a 30-day-money-back-guarantee. Now to identify the roles and user rights for that authenticated user application needs to perform authorization checks. Set your Reply URL in the app registration and in the web.config (or app settings) to wherever you want the user to be directed. If youre only visiting big sites, then you are used to the following scenario: You enter your log-in information but you mistype your password or email. Alternatively, you can follow the procedure below: Copy the RemoteConnector folder from the installation directory to a location where you have read/write permissions. This can be done in the following ways. If you clicked on a link, confirm that its pointing to the page youre trying to access (or try to visit that page directly through the website). Search on google . Clearing the cache will remove any problems in those files and give the page an opportunity to download fresh files directly from the server. What exactly makes a black hole STAY a black hole? Depending on the site youre accessing, you might see this error message along with other graphic elements, as opposed to plaintext on a white background. Do check authorization behavior section for additional options. I do have the Reply URL set. If youre a frequent browser, chances are youll encounter this message at some point. How to Track and Manage the IP Addresses on your Network using IP Address Manager. If it has, you can manually activate each plugin one at a time, in order to determine which one is causing the problem. The following messages are also client-side errors and so are related to the 401 Unauthorized error:400 Bad Request,403 Forbidden,404 Not Found, and408 Request Timeout. How can i extract files in the directory where they're located with the find command? What's the difference between 401 Unauthorized and 403 Forbidden? Global audience reach with 35 data centers worldwide. A complete list of HTTP status codes with explaination of what they are, why they occur and what you can do to fix them. I get a 401 because it keeps asking for credentials. To create a policy that blocks Basic authentication for all available client protocols in Exchange Online (the recommended configuration), use the following syntax: PowerShell. Flush the DNS: Errors in DNS also creates 401 error status sometimes. Found footage movie where teens get superpowers after getting struck by lightning?

How To Create Web App In Android Studio, Dinamo Zagreb Vs Hajduk Split Tv, Drenched In Liquid Crossword, Emarketer Ecommerce Growth, Gatsby Allow Cross Origin, Ark Additions Xiphactinus, Every Summer After Summary,

Pesquisar